Сборщик RSS-лент

Как я модель устройства в QEMU на Rust писал. Часть 1. Разбор интеграции Rust в QEMU

Habr.com - вт, 05/13/2025 - 22:16

С недавнего времени в QEMU появилась экспериментальная возможность создания моделей устройств на языке Rust, вместо традиционного C. Меня эта тема очень заинтересовала, и я не смог пройти мимо и не попробовать не создать модель устройства PCI на этом языке. За основу взял реализацию EDU на C.

Делюсь, через что мне пришлось пройти, и что из этого вышло. Эта часть посвящена разбору интеграции Rust в QEMU.

Читать далее

Управление качеством данных в 1С: Как бизнес-аналитику обеспечить доверие к аналитике

Habr.com - вт, 05/13/2025 - 22:11

Качество данных становится одним из ключевых факторов успеха в любой автоматизации, особенно когда речь идет о таких системах, как 1С. Ошибки в данных могут привести к серьезным проблемам, включая финансовые потери и замедление роста бизнеса. В этой статье мы рассмотрим подходы и инструменты, которые бизнес-аналитики могут использовать для обеспечения доверия к данным, а также роль, которую они играют в процессе управления качеством данных в системе 1С.

Читать далее

Генетический алгоритм в помощь Adam — супер, но есть нюанс

Habr.com - вт, 05/13/2025 - 21:15

Хабр привет!

Это моя первая статья и я хотел бы начать ее с такого интересного эксперимента как "сбор гибрида для обучения нейронных сетей с помощью генетического алгоритма" и дополнительно рассказать про библиотеку Deap.

Давайте определим из чего у нас будет состоять наш гибрид (как можно понять из названия) - это:

1) Обычный проход градиентного спуска ...

Читать далее

Нужна ли агентам ИИ «этика в весах»?

Habr.com - вт, 05/13/2025 - 21:01

Я не специалист ни в этике, ни в выравнивании — это размышления «из зала» о том, где в архитектуре ИИ должна жить этика. Возможно, кому‑то будет полезно обсудить альтернативный взгляд.

1. Аналогия: пуля и промпт

Большие языковые модели (LLM) часто сравнивают с «умной пулей». Промпт задаёт траекторию, а модель, преодолевая шумы, летит к цели. Задача разработчика — свести рассеивание к минимуму.

Стандартный подход к этическому выравниванию (AI alignment) пытается «править» полет пули внешней средой: поверх цели накладываются дополнительные фильтры, правила, штрафы за неэтичный текст и т. д.

Читать далее

Личный VPN: юзер ликует, VLESS смеётся, а РКН плачет

Habr.com - вт, 05/13/2025 - 20:51

Эта статья — расширенный туториал того, как установить и настроить свой VPN на VLESS с XTLS-Reality с управлением через GUI интерфейс 3x-UI всего за 10 минут.

Читать далее

Qt for Python: PySide6

Habr.com - вт, 05/13/2025 - 20:45

Статья для новичков про использование Qt на языке Python используя официальную библиотеку-привязку PySide6. Ознакомление с созданием графических приложений на языке Python.

Читать далее

Атака на уязвимую систему Deathnote Vulnhub. Получение доступа к системе пользователя и суперпользователя root. Часть 7

Habr.com - вт, 05/13/2025 - 20:36

Всех приветствую, читатели Хабра!

Седьмая часть анализа защищенности, правда в этот раз системы (серверной) Vulnhub. Система я поднимал на virtualbox, а не на докер, то есть иной метод виртуализации.

Вот ссылки на первые четыре части уязвимых веб-приложений, советую ознакомиться:

https://habr.com/ru/articles/894508/
https://habr.com/ru/articles/895092/
https://habr.com/ru/articles/895856/
https://habr.com/ru/articles/897296/
https://habr.com/ru/articles/898918/ (это уязвимая ОС на virtualbox)
https://habr.com/ru/articles/902248/

Примечание

Правовая информация:

Данная статья создана исключительно в ознакомительных/образовательных/развивающих целях.
Автор статьи не несет ответственности за ваши действия.
Автор статьи ни к чему не призывает, более того напоминаю о существовании некоторых статей в уголовном кодексе РФ, их никто не отменял:
УК РФ Статья 272. Неправомерный доступ к компьютерной информации
УК РФ Статья 273. Создание, использование и распространение вредоносных компьютерных программ
УК РФ Статья 274. Нарушение правил эксплуатации средств хранения, обработки или передачи компьютерной информации и информационно-телекоммуникационных сетей

Все атаки я проводил на локальный сервер, внутри моего сетевого интерфейса, на моем компьютере, то есть все действия легитимны.

И как всегда просьба не переходить на личности в комментариях, если вы обнаружили ошибку недочет или неточность, просто без оскорблений напишите комментарий или напишите мне личным сообщением. здесь я всего лишь делюсь опытом взлома уязвимой машины

Читать далее

[Перевод] Исследование: как собаки и кошки эволюционируют, становясь похожими друг на друга, и почему в этом виноваты люди

Habr.com - вт, 05/13/2025 - 20:29

Одомашнивание сделало кошек и собак более разнообразными, но в то же время удивительно похожими друг на друга, что серьёзно сказывается на их здоровье и благополучии, показывают новые исследования.

На первый взгляд кажется, что у персидских кошек и мопсов не так уж много общего. Одна — кошка, другая — собака, а между ними — 50 миллионов лет эволюции. Но когда биолог-эволюционист Эбби Грейс Дрейк и её коллеги просканировали 1 810 черепов кошек, собак и их диких родственников, они обнаружили нечто странное. Несмотря на далёкое прошлое, многие породы кошек и собак демонстрируют поразительное сходство в форме черепа.

Читать далее

Квантовый день на Nvidia GTC. Когда сказка станет реальностью?

Habr.com - вт, 05/13/2025 - 20:18

Квантовый день на Nvidia GTC. Когда сказка станет реальностью?

Квантовые компьютеры - когда ждать и чего бояться? Детальный разбор этого исторического для всей отрасли события.

Спойлер - сразу после ивента, акции 3х публичных квантовых компаний упали на 35-40%

Читать далее

Как отличить человека от ИИ

Habr.com - вт, 05/13/2025 - 20:15

В современном интернете «боты» и «машины» научились вести себя почти как люди: генерировать тексты, кликать по ссылкам, заполнять формы. Чтобы защитить сервисы от мошенников и сохранить чистоту данных, необходимы гибридные механизмы «контрольного фильтра»: сочетание видимых тестов (CAPTCHA), невидимой аналитики поведения и серверных проверок. В этой статье мы пройдём путь от простейших ловушек до невидимого скоринга, изучим сильные и слабые стороны каждого метода и подумаем, куда двинется борьба «человек ↔ ИИ» дальше.

Читать далее

История развития языковых моделей: ч. 2, от ChatGPT до рассуждающего режима

Habr.com - вт, 05/13/2025 - 20:14

Доброго времени суток, «Хабр»!

В предыдущей части мы рассмотрели историю языковых моделей от робких шагов Маркова до долгой краткосрочной памяти. Сегодня мы продолжим, пройдемся по ключевым архитектурам последних лет и разберём, как модели научились интерпретировать контекст, предсказывать и даже спорить логически.

Пристегните токены — вход в зону трансформаций!

Читать далее

«А скока бонусов дадут?» - Искусство общения с респондентами: «вредные» и практические советы

Habr.com - вт, 05/13/2025 - 20:01

Искусство общения с респондентами: «вредные» и практические советы.

В современном мире исследования стали неотъемлемой частью принятия решений — от выбора фильма на вечер до разработки инновационных технологий. Но что делает их по-настоящему ценными? Конечно, люди, которые делятся своим опытом — респонденты.  В этой статье я поделюсь опытом общения с разными участниками исследований, а также дам практические советы, как сделать интервью максимально эффективным. 

Читать далее

История развития языковых моделей: ч. 1, от цепей Маркова до ELIZA

Habr.com - вт, 05/13/2025 - 19:59

Доброго времени суток, «Хабр»!

2025 год на дворе, а мы уже успели познакомиться с сотнями языковых моделей, чьи возможности по-настоящему впечатляют. Написать осмысленный текст, проанализировать текст, найти в нём ключевые мысли? Без каких-либо проблем.

Но задумывались ли вы, как всё начиналось? Что существовало до эпохи языковых моделей — и было ли это «до» вообще? В сегодняшней статье мы совершим путешествие к истокам и найдем ответы на все вопросы.

Пристегните ремни — будет познавательно!

Читать далее

Первый проект на HarmonyOS — мой плейлист для старта с нуля

Habr.com - вт, 05/13/2025 - 19:56

Привет, Хабр! Это Юрий Волковский, техлид фронтенда в компании Friflex. Я работаю, в том числе, с мобильными приложениями на React Native. Разработка под HarmonyOS сразу заинтриговала меня тем, что ArkTS — это как бы TypeScript, но не совсем. И сам ArkUI сочетает в себе элементы и из React Native, и из Flutter, который мне тоже знаком. 

Я решил: создам на Harmony OS базовое мобильное приложение и посмотрю, насколько дружелюбна эта платформа. Если вы мобильный разработчик (особенно с опытом Android или Flutter) и тоже хотите разобраться, что это за платформа и как с ней работать — вы по адресу. Создадим базовый плейлист по шагам.

Читать далее

Переходим от legacy к построению Feature Store

Habr.com - вт, 05/13/2025 - 19:45

Невероятная история о том, как внедрить систему Feature Store в проект с огромным legacy и получить профит.

Привет, Хабр! Меня зовут Евгений Дащенко, я из компании «Домклик», которая решает все вопросы, связанные с недвижимостью, включая оценку стоимости недвижимости любого типа. Это статья по мотивам моего доклада на конференции Highload++ про интерфейс между данными и ML-моделями Feature Store: как мы сделали его с нашей командой, каких результатов добились и с какими подводными камнями столкнулись на пути.

Читать далее

Интервью про ИИ, которое меня выбесило

Habr.com - вт, 05/13/2025 - 19:45

Потому что в нём опять всё плохо, 80% специалистов скоро будут никому не нужны, а все мы через семь лет будем ходить на поводке у роботов. 

Читать

Новая генеративная модель Kandinsky 3D для создания 3D-объектов. Как она работает и кому будет полезна

Habr.com - вт, 05/13/2025 - 19:40

Салют, Хабр! В прошлом году мы рассказали о наших исследованиях и разработках в сфере генеративных моделей для 3D-контента, а теперь открываем доступ для тестирования. Встречайте первый российский сервис для генерации 3D-моделей по текстовому описанию или изображению — Kandinsky 3D.

Читать далее

10 ошибок QA и как их избежать

Habr.com - вт, 05/13/2025 - 19:36

QA-инженеры часто сталкиваются с неожиданным поведением системы, которое не описано в User Story или критериях приемки. Если вы не уверены, всегда документируйте и сообщайте о проблеме. Четкий отчет поможет стейкхолдерам определить, является ли это дефектом, отсутствующим требованием или ожидаемым поведением.

Если проблема сложна или непонятна, не стесняйтесь назначить встречу с руководителем. Это может быть реальная ошибка, известная проблема или что-то, что запланировано к исправлению в будущем. Кто знает?

Читать далее

Идеальный процесс взаимодействия аналитика и мобильного разработчика

Habr.com - вт, 05/13/2025 - 19:30

Данную статью написали Александр Чекунков, Android-разработчик, и Антон Ушаков, аналитик. Мы работаем в СБЕРе и ежедневно взаимодействуем, чтобы превращать бизнес-требования в понятные, логичные и реализуемые решения. В своей работе мы ежедневно сталкиваемся с процессами формирования требований, их обсуждения, реализации и доставки фичи до промышленных стендов. От того, насколько правильно выстроена наша работа, напрямую зависит скорость и качество разработки продукта.

В этой статье мы рассмотрим зоны ответственности обеих ролей и покажем, как, по нашему мнению, должен выглядеть идеальный процесс взаимодействия. Наша цель — помочь командам выстроить прозрачное и продуктивное взаимодействие, избежать типичных ошибок и сделать совместную работу более эффективной.

Читать далее

Забавы в ближнем инфракрасном. Часть 1. Сенсорная система для начинающего радиолюбителя

Habr.com - вт, 05/13/2025 - 19:17

Нынешние инфракрасный пульт и сопряжённый с ним приёмник, например, для дистанционного управления телевизором, энергетически очень экономичны и могут месяцами работать от батарейки. Однако, имейте в виду: это весьма непростые штучки. Мало того, что в пульте исходное излучение  искусственно модулируют ультразвуковой частотой (чтобы отличить его от излучения других источников). Поверх его одевают ещё и в цифровой сигнал телеграфного типа (коды команд).

Вряд ли начинающий радиолюбитель захочет спаять аппаратуру для такого винегрета из радиодеталей общего назначения (“рассыпухи”), на коленке. Проще купить в магазине готовую специализированную микросхему приёмника и подать  на неё питание. Прекрасная идея для юного радиолюбителя. Мда…

А что, можно как-то по другому? Можно. Давайте почувствуем себя ненадолго радиолюбителями далёкого прошлого. Ну-ну, не пугайтесь. Это всего лишь игра.

Далее:

- Имени Коминтерна
- Инфракрасный “передатчик” и инфракрасный “детекторный приёмник”
- Простейшая инфракрасная сенсорная система
- Что дальше?

Читать далее

Сейчас на сайте

Сейчас на сайте 0 пользователей и 3 гостя.
Ленты новостей